PEOPLE - Toa Medical Electronics (UK) announces staff changes:
This article was originally published in Clinica
Executive Summary
Toa Medical Electronics (UK) has announced some staff changes. Michelle Millman, formerly with Colchester District General Hospital, has joined as product specialist for the Sysmex haematology product range. She will work with Lisa Young, haemostasis product specialist and Rick Starkie, immunology product specialist. Andy Hay is overall product manager and Rob Kaukis is promoted to field manager. (Toa will shortly relocate to an adjacent building in Milton Keynes, due to expansion, but its telephone & fax numbers will remain the same).
